As of May 17, 2024, Datafold has decided to cease active support and development for the open source data-diff tool to concentrate on enhancing their primary product, Datafold Cloud. Datafold was founded in 2020 to address critical aspects of data quality in a data engineer's workflow, such as data reconciliation and transformation code changes, through technology that compares datasets at any scale. Initially launched as a SaaS product, Datafold later introduced data-diff as an open source tool to increase accessibility within the community. However, the increasing demand for Datafold Cloud and the need to maintain two separate products with overlapping features have prompted the decision to focus exclusively on the SaaS offering. The company believes concentrating resources on Datafold Cloud will ultimately benefit its customers and the company, despite ending the open source project. Datafold plans to continue innovating data quality testing, having recently implemented improvements like sampling, real-time results, and enhanced database support, as they aim to cover the entire data quality lifecycle.
